The purpose of this Meetup group is to encourage and foster participatory singing in the San Francisco Bay Area, to be a forum where people who love to sing can connect with like-minded individuals and groups. Organizations that list events with this Meetup group include: CircleSing A term coined by Bobby McFerrin, CircleSinging refers to a group collaborative song created in the moment. Love to sing? What's stopping you? The Organic Women's Chorus is ready to help you start again. We are an informal and welcoming group of women who love singing together in community. Our weekly meetings are part singing, part support group, part family reunion, and another part singing! The Organic Women's Chorus started in April, 2009 with a group of women who met at Women Making Music camp (more info at www.womamu.org) and wanted to sing together more regularly and locally. Circle Sing is a women’s singing group that sings and harmonizes inspirational music from many traditions. It’s relaxed, lively, and full of heart. Each session includes breathing and vocal warm ups, a short session in sight singing, and most of all lots of singing and harmonizing. We encourage beginners as well as seasoned group singers.
